✦ Synopsis


Network-based concurrent computing and interactive data visualization are two important components in industry applications of high-performance computing and communication. We propose an execution framework to build interactive remote visualization systems for realworld applications on heterogeneous parallel and distributed computers. Using a dataflow model of a commercial visualization software AVS in three case studies, we demonstrate a simple, effective, and modular approach to couple parallel simulation modules into an interactive remote visualization environment. The applications described in this paper are drawn from our industrial projects in financial modeling, computational electromagnetics and computational chemistry.
